Benefits of a PR Strategy for a Business

 

In today’s fast-paced and competitive business world, having a solid PR (public relations) strategy is crucial for any company looking to establish a strong brand presence, enhance its reputation, and maintain a positive image in the eyes of its stakeholders. A well-planned and executed PR strategy can help a business in several ways, and in this article, we’ll discuss the key benefits of having a PR strategy.

 

Enhancing Brand Awareness

One of the primary benefits of a PR strategy is that it helps to increase brand awareness among the target audience. By developing a comprehensive PR plan, businesses can leverage media relations, influencer marketing, thought leadership, and social media to reach their target customers and build brand recognition.

 

For instance, a company featured in a reputable industry publication can attract the attention of potential customers and gain valuable exposure. Similarly, by collaborating with industry influencers, businesses can tap into their followers’ fan base and expand their reach.

 

Building Credibility and Trust

Trust is essential for any business, and PR can help build credibility and establish trust with stakeholders. Companies can create a positive image and maintain a good reputation by proactively communicating with customers, investors, and other stakeholders. This step can be achieved through various tactics such as thought leadership, crisis management, and community outreach.

 

For example, a company that shares its expertise and insights through thought leadership content such as blogs, whitepapers, and webinars can position itself as an authority in its field, enhancing its reputation and credibility. Similarly, by handling a crisis transparently and effectively, businesses can demonstrate their commitment to transparency and honesty, which can help build trust with customers and other stakeholders.

 

Improving Customer Relations

Another significant benefit of a PR strategy is that it can help businesses improve customer relations. Companies can gain valuable insights into their customer’s needs and preferences by developing a robust customer engagement program that includes media monitoring, social media listening, and feedback management. This information can then be used to tailor their products and services to better meet their customer’s needs, improve their customer experience, and build stronger relationships.

 

Attracting and Retaining Talent

A positive brand image and reputation can also help businesses attract and retain top talent. With the increasing competition for skilled professionals, having a strong employer brand is crucial for companies to attract the best candidates.

 

A PR strategy can help businesses showcase their company culture, values, and achievements to potential candidates, creating a positive perception of the company as a desirable workplace. Similarly, businesses can demonstrate their commitment to employee recognition and retention by celebrating their employees’ accomplishments.

 

Increasing Sales and Revenue

Finally, a well-executed PR strategy can help businesses increase their sales and revenue by attracting new customers and retaining existing ones. Companies can create buzz and generate interest in their products and services by leveraging various PR tactics such as product launches, promotions, and influencer partnerships.

 

For instance, a company that collaborates with a famous influencer can attract the influencer’s followers and drive sales. Similarly, by using PR tactics to highlight their products’ unique features and benefits, businesses can differentiate themselves from their competitors and increase sales and revenue.

Businesses should also focus on measuring the effectiveness of their PR strategy through key performance indicators (KPIs). These may include metrics such as media coverage, social media engagement, website traffic, lead generation, and revenue generated. By regularly monitoring and analyzing these KPIs, businesses can make informed decisions about their PR tactics, adjust their strategy as needed, and ensure that their efforts deliver the desired results.
